POWL Price Target Analysis

Updated May 6, 2026

As of May 6, 2026, Powell Industries, Inc. (POWL) has a Wall Street consensus price target of $213.67, based on estimates from 9 covering analysts. With the stock currently trading at $320.30, this represents a potential downside of -33.3%. The company has a market capitalization of $11.67B.

Analyst price targets range from a low of $142.33 to a high of $285.00, representing a 67% spread in expectations. The median target of $213.67 aligns closely with the consensus average. The wide target spread reflects significant disagreement on fair value.

The current analyst consensus rating is Hold, with 2 analysts rating the stock as a Buy or Strong Buy,6 rating it Hold, and 1 rating it Sell or Strong Sell. The bearish sentiment suggests caution about the stock at current levels.

From a valuation perspective, POWL trades at a trailing P/E of 64.7x and forward P/E of 58.0x. The forward PEG ratio of 0.97 suggests the stock may be undervalued relative to its growth. Analysts expect EPS to grow +8.0% over the next year.
